Department: HM TreasuryThese Regulations provide for an exemption from income tax for income arising to individuals because of their involvement in the 19th World Athletics Indoor Championships that are to be held in Glasgow between 1st and 3rd March 2024.

Asked by: Emma Lewell-Buck (Labour - South Shields)
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:
To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, how many never events occurred within NHS England in each year since 2019; and how many and what proportion of these incidents involved Physician Associates in each year.
Answered by Maria Caulfield - Parliamentary Under Secretary of State (Department for Business and Trade) (Minister for Women)
Information on Never Events is published by NHS England, and all available data on Never Events is available at the following link:
https://www.england.nhs.uk/patient-safety/never-events-data/
NHS England does not collect specific data relating to Physician Associate involvement in Never Events, and as such the information is not held.
